Di Montezemolo: I'm not stepping down from Ferrari anytime soon

+ Ferrari president Luca di Montezemolo has rubbished rumours that he is set to step down from his position at the Scuderia. Rumours were rife ahead of the Italian Grand Prix, suggesting that the long-time Ferrari boss was set to step down in favour of Fiat CEO Sergio Marchionne. However, di Montezemolo, who appeared at Monza on Saturday, has dismissed the rumours out of hand, and says far from leaving the company he has recently promised to extend his stay with Ferrari by another three years. “I've heard a lot of rumours regarding myself,” di Montezemolo said. “This often happens in the summer in Italy, and maybe this time it is a little bit too much. “I am working, I am not here...
